In the case of an unquoted string (uses the “colon-equal[-equal]” sequence), all text becomes upper case, and leading and trailing spaces and TABs are trimmed off. If the unquoted string contains an embedded quoted string, the case and content of the quoted portion of the string will be preserved.
Comment delimiters are observed as usual. The comment is not considered part of the unquoted string.
